Welcome to our new river side restaurant in the heart of downtown Sarnia. We are located at 265 Front St N in the St Clair Corporate Center. Parking is available on the north side and access to our place is available around back.

Located inside the St. Clair building, at the back, First floor with the view of the river. Intimate setting. Casual lunches, including wraps and salads, averaging around $18, and upscale dinners starting at the $30 mark. Vegetarian options: Had an eggplant dish on dinner menu, lots of salads to choose from during lunch.
